  • Copper In Drinking Water


    Rebecca Kriss, a PhD candidate at Virginia Tech University who’s studying copper in drinking water and the best treatment options, is the guest on the latest WQA Radio podcast. Kriss discusses the health effects of copper and why copper tends to be more of a problem in newer homes.
